Required Qualifications:
- Valid EASA CPL(A) with ATPL(A) theory completed or EASA ATPL(A).
- Valid multi-engine IR(A) rating (must remain valid until the end of the course).
- Minimum of 70 hours as pilot in command of aeroplanes.
- Certificate of completion of MCC Training.
- Certificate of completion of Advanced UPRT course as specified in FCL.745.A (applies to the issue of the first type rating course for a multi-pilot aeroplane).
- Minimum ICAO English Language Proficiency: Level 4.
- Valid Class 1 Medical Certificate.
- Fluent in spoken and written Greek.
- Valid Greek Tax Registration Number (ΑΦΜ) and Greek Social Security Number (ΑΜΚΑ).
- Completed Military Service Obligations when applicable (or be legitimately excused).
